Pheresis, Inc. has recently garnered attention as one of the top small-cap stocks to consider for investment. On September 5, Truist Financial announced an increase in the price target for Pheresis, raising it from $35 to $36 while maintaining a Buy rating on the stock. This decision reflects a positive outlook on the company's performance and growth potential.
Jailendra Singh, an analyst at Truist, adjusted the price target following insightful discussions during a post-quarter call. The adjustment signals confidence in Pheresis's strategic direction and financial health. Investors are likely to view this move as a strong endorsement of the company's prospects in the market.
As Pheresis continues to develop its offerings and expand its market presence, analysts believe that the stock could provide significant returns. The increased price target further solidifies Pheresis's position as an attractive option for those looking to invest in promising small-cap stocks.
